We talk with four-time CrossFit Games athlete Paige Rogers about pregnancy, postpartum training, and how becoming a mom changed her mindset on competition, body image, and purpose. She shares practical modifications, pelvic floor insights, backlash she faced, and what’s next at Rogue. • first real competition back and why pressure dropped • early pregnancy fatigue, nausea and letting go of control • safe lifting during pregnancy and watching for coning • training by feel with support from an...
